We want to hear your thoughts on how to improve and organise the land at Matarangi Omaro Reserve (by the boat ramp). Our goal is to ensure this area remains a welcoming open space for the entire community, particularly for families with children.
We’ve spoken to various local groups about this space and now is your chance to be part of the conversation.
We invite you to think about what this means for the reserve and how we can make it a more enjoyable place for everyone. We are looking for suggestions that focus on improving the usability and family-friendliness of the space, such as:
Your feedback will help us identify the most important improvements for Omaro reserve. Once we gather your ideas, we’ll summarise them to show what the community wants. This summary will inform our operational decisions, help us plan future improvements and decide what changes to prioritise for our next Long Term Plan. If there are big ideas, we’ll also share those with the Community Board.
